浅析html 空格代码
H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言,其中包含了各种标签和实体来实现网页的布局和格式化。在HTML中,空格的处理可能会比其他编程或标记语言有所不同,因为浏览器会自动合并连续的空格。本文将深入探讨HTML中的空格代码及其使用方法。 我们要了解HTML中的基本空格代码——不间断空格【 】。这个字符实体实际上是一个非破坏性空格,与键盘上空格键产生的空格不同。在HTML源代码中,当你使用【 】时,浏览器会显示一个固定宽度的空格,不会被浏览器自动压缩或删除,这使得它在布局和对齐文本时非常有用。 在HTML中,如果你直接输入多个空格,浏览器在渲染时通常只会识别为一个空格。所以,如果你需要在网页上创建多个空格,就需要使用不间断空格【 】实体。例如,如果你想在两个词之间插入三个空格,你可以写作:“Hello World”。这将在网页上显示为“Hello World”。 另外,我们可以通过调整字体大小来改变空格的视觉效果。在HTML中,每个空格的宽度通常等于当前字体的宽度。所以,如果你改变了元素的字体大小,空格的视觉宽度也会相应改变。如以下代码所示: ```html <span style="font-size:12px;"> </span> 12px的字体大小,显示三个空格<br> <span style="font-size:36px;"> </span> 36px的字体大小,同样显示三个空格<br> ``` 在这个例子中,虽然都是三个不间断空格,但由于设置了不同的字体大小,因此它们在页面上的占用空间是不同的。较大的字体大小会使空格看起来更宽。 除了【 】,HTML还提供了其他字符实体来处理空格和缩进,例如: - 【 】:半宽空格,宽度为正常空格的一半。 - 【 】:全角空格,宽度为正常空格的两倍。 - 【 】:细空格,宽度小于半宽空格。 这些实体可以灵活地帮助你调整文本间的间隔,以达到理想的排版效果。 理解和正确使用HTML的空格代码对于创建具有清晰布局和良好可读性的网页至关重要。通过掌握不间断空格【 】以及其他相关的字符实体,你可以更精确地控制网页上的文字间距,从而提升用户体验。在实践中,你可能会遇到各种布局需求,而HTML的空格代码正是解决这些问题的关键工具之一。